A restaurant in Lancashire has been named among the best UK restaurants that offer cheap meals and are recommended by Michelin chefs.

Along with chefs at Michelin-starred restaurants, top bloggers are also picking their favourites in a list by Sky News.

The list will be updated every week, recommending more and more restaurants and eateries.

Introducing the list, Sky News said: “Throughout 2024 we're asking Michelin-starred chefs and top bloggers to pick their favourite cheap eats - a meal for two for less than £40 - in their part of the UK. We'll add to this list every week...”

In Lancashire, Jungle in Clitheroe is recommended.

What did the chef say about Jungle?

Lisa Goodwin-Allen, executive chef of the Michelin-starred restaurant Northcote, said: “I love Jungle on the high street in Clitheroe. I go there a lot for brunch with my husband and my son.

“It's great value for money and just has a really cool, relaxed atmosphere, and they serve really tasty food. They have things like sweetcorn fritters with chilli jam and shakshuka with a falafel scotch egg on the menu.

“The dishes always have a twist to them. It also feels great to be able to give back to the brilliant independents on the local high street.”

Jungle has been praised on Tripadvisor by visitors, earning it a 4.5/5 star rating from 64 reviews, at the time of writing.

One visitor said: “Warm welcome. Lovely service. Great coffee and very good food (homemade beans with egg on sourdough). Spot on, all round. Can happily recommend.”
